Aundh
Aundh is a village located in Meerganj tehsil of Bareilly district in Uttar Pradesh, India. It is situated 14km away from sub-district headquarter Meerganj (tehsildar office) and 20km away from district headquarter Bareilly. As per 2009 stats, Aundh village is also a gram panchayat.

About Aundh
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Aundh is 129625. The village spans a total geographical area of 242.31 hectares. Fatehganj is nearest town to Aundh village for all major economic activities.
When it comes to local governance, Aundh village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Meerganj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Bareilly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Aundh
Below is a concise population overview of Aundh as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 1,681 | 899 | 782 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 266 | 134 | 132 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| 259 | 128 | 131 |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| N/A | N/A | N/A |
Literate Population | 935 | 556 | 379 |
Illiterate Population | 746 | 343 | 403 |
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Aundh village:
- The total population of Aundh village is around 1,681, including approximately 899 males and 782 females, with a sex ratio of 869 females per 1,000 males.
- There are about 266 children aged 0–6 years in Aundh village, reflecting the young population in the village.
- Aundh village has 259 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C).
- The literacy rate of Aundh village is about 55.62%, with male literacy at 61.85% and female literacy at 48.47%.
- There are around 297 households in Aundh village.
Connectivity of Aundh
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Aundh. As per the 2011 stats, Aundh had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within <5 km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within <5 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within <5 km distance |
